Career Path

Blockchain Developer for Agri-Tech

Design and implement blockchain solutions to enhance transparency and efficiency in agricultural supply chains.

IoT Solutions Architect

Develop IoT systems to monitor and optimize agricultural processes, such as crop management and livestock tracking.

Data Analyst for Smart Farming

Analyze data from IoT devices and blockchain systems to provide actionable insights for precision agriculture.

Agri-Tech Consultant

Advise agricultural businesses on integrating blockchain and IoT technologies to improve productivity and sustainability.

The Graduate Certificate in Blockchain and Internet of Things (IoT) for Agriculture is a pivotal qualification in today’s market, addressing the growing demand for advanced technological solutions in the agricultural sector. In the UK, agriculture contributes approximately £10.3 billion to the economy annually, with 72% of farms adopting some form of digital technology to enhance productivity. Blockchain and IoT are revolutionizing the industry by enabling traceability, improving supply chain efficiency, and optimizing resource management. For instance, IoT-enabled sensors can monitor soil health and crop conditions in real-time, while blockchain ensures transparent and secure data sharing across stakeholders. The UK government’s Agricultural Transition Plan emphasizes the adoption of sustainable practices, with £270 million allocated to innovation and productivity grants in 2023.
